sagas库0.3.5版本发布:Python后端开发利器

版权申诉
0 下载量 26 浏览量 更新于2024-10-11 收藏 1.24MB ZIP 举报
资源摘要信息:"Python库sagas是一个适用于Python编程语言的开发库,版本号为0.3.5。它是一个wheel格式的文件,wheel是Python的一种包安装格式,它是PEP 427中定义的一种归档格式,用于分发Python的库。wheel格式的文件后缀通常为.whl,它与传统的源码包(.tar.gz)相比,安装过程更快,因为它可以跳过编译步骤。wheel文件通常包含以下内容:包含了编译后的共享库的文件(.pyd 或 .so),在Windows和Unix系统中分别使用;包含了纯Python模块文件(.py);以及一系列的元数据文件,用于描述包的依赖、版本信息等。解压后,该文件将允许Python开发者在项目中直接引用并使用sagas库中的模块和功能,提升开发效率和代码的可复用性。" 在详细说明标题和描述中所说的知识点之前,我们先来梳理一下与Python库、Python开发语言、后端开发以及wheel文件相关的概念。 - **Python库**: Python库是使用Python编写的代码集合,通常包含一些函数和类的定义,用于完成特定的任务或功能。库可以分为标准库和第三方库。标准库是Python语言的一部分,随Python解释器一起安装,无需额外下载。第三方库则需要通过包管理工具如pip来安装。 - **Python开发语言**: Python是一种高级的、解释型的编程语言,由Guido van Rossum于1989年底发明。Python的设计哲学强调代码的可读性和简洁的语法(尤其是使用空格缩进来区分代码块,而不是使用大括号或关键字)。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。 - **后端开发**: 后端开发通常指的是服务器端的开发工作,包括服务器、应用程序和数据库的交互。后端开发者需要处理数据的存储、访问和管理,确保网站或应用程序能够正确响应用户请求。后端通常涉及多种编程语言和技术栈,Python也是其中一种非常流行的后端开发语言,尤其在使用Django和Flask等Web框架时。 - **Wheel文件**: Wheel是Python的一种包分发格式,旨在加速Python包的安装过程。它是PEP 427规范的产物,是包管理工具pip的推荐分发格式。与传统的源码包相比,wheel文件在安装时不需重新编译,从而可以减少安装时间和网络消耗。Wheel文件是一个ZIP归档文件,包含一个或多个Python扩展模块或包,并且符合特定的布局和元数据要求。 针对提供的文件信息,知识点可以进一步细化为: - **文件命名约定**: sagas-0.3.5-py3-none-any.whl文件名遵循了Python包分发的命名约定。其中“sagas”是包名,“0.3.5”是版本号,表明这是一个第三方库的分发版本。"py3"说明这个包是为Python 3版本设计的,"none"指的是这个包没有任何平台特定的安装要求,"any"表示它可以适用于任何平台。 - **安装方法**: 使用pip安装wheel文件是一个简单直接的过程。在命令行中,开发者可以使用以下命令安装该文件: ``` pip install sagas-0.3.5-py3-none-any.whl ``` 这会将sagas库安装到当前Python环境中,使开发者能够开始使用它提供的功能。 - **库功能**: 标题和描述没有具体说明sagas库提供了哪些功能。通常,一个第三方库可能会提供特定领域的问题解决方法,如数据处理、机器学习、网络编程、测试框架等。了解库的功能需要查阅该库的官方文档或者通过安装后查看内置的帮助文档。 - **兼容性**: 由于该库标注为"py3",意味着它是为Python 3版本所设计的。这表明它可能不与Python 2.x版本兼容。开发者在使用时需要确保其开发环境使用的是Python 3。 - **使用场景**: 如前所述,一个第三方库的使用场景取决于它所提供的功能和模块。sagas库可以被应用在需要该库功能的任何后端项目中,例如数据处理、科学计算、网络服务等。 - **更新和维护**: 库的版本号“0.3.5”表明这是一个较早的版本,通常版本号中,数字越大表示版本越新。开发人员在选择使用库时应考虑版本的更新和支持情况,以确保获得最新的功能以及潜在的安全修复。 总结来说,sagas-0.3.5-py3-none-any.whl是一个适用于Python 3的第三方库文件,通过wheel格式进行快速安装,以便在后端开发项目中使用。开发者在安装和使用该库之前,应了解其具体功能、兼容性及维护情况,以确保它满足项目需求。